18x2+4 - [ 6(x2-2) +5]

we use PEDMAS

first we have to perform operation inside Parentheses \"( )\"

after that we go for exponents (power and squareroots)

then Divison and multiplication from left to right

last we gor for Addition and subtraction from left to right

we follow this rule to solve our problem

18x2+4 - [ 6(x2-2) +5]

first we will operate inside Parentheses

18x^2 + 4 - [ 6x2 - 12 + 5]          we have distributed \"6\" over the bracket (x^2 - 2) . so we multiply 6 inside the bracket terms

18x^2 + 4 - [ 6x2 - 7 ]    // -12 +5 = -7

18x2 + 4 - 6x2 + 7   // whenever there is a negative sign before a bracket we reverse the sign of the terms inside the bracket.

12x2 + 11

answer
